Pivot table of software reported inWord
- Copy the file Software.xls to your own drive.
- Insert a row at the top of the sheet with the headings Type, Object, Price, Supplier,
Web address and SA Computer Magazine Edition. Make the headings bold.
- In the last few tasks (Stock costs, Stock counts)
you have used the SumIf and CountIf functions and formulaes to find the costs and numbers
of things. It could be done so quickly and simply using a pivot table.
- Create a pivot table showing the Type and total Prices. Look at the tip sheet for
Excel PivotTable.
- Create some new pivot tables. Explore - be creative.
- Open Word, and a new file.
- Do a Copy / Paste from Excel to Word of one simple pivot table.
- Insert a caption below the table with the label Table whatever it is (Insert
/ Caption).
- Leave an open line, then add 1 or 2 lines of text to explain the table.
- In the sentences about the table add a Cross-reference to refer to the table by number
(Insert / Cross-reference). Make sure the cross-reference is to Only label and
number.
